Algorithmus linealis cum pulchris conditionibus duarum regularum de tri,
vna de integris, altera vero de fractis, regulisque socialibus, et semper exemplis idoneis adiunctis. Accesserunt priori aeditioni regulae quaedam utilissimae. Nunc denuo reuisus et correctus. Cracoviae 1556. apud viduam Hieronymi Schar(ffenberg) Anno ab orbe redempto. MDLVI. (15.5 x 10 cm), pp. [28], woodcut diagrams in the text, (woodcut printer's vignette at end): in a bordered frame two etiquettes hold a shield, on which the letters: I. S. H. (Jerome Scharffenberg) entwined, cover broch. 19th/20th c.
(Estr. T. 21). On the reverse of the title, preface: ad lectorem. The first edition was published in 1513 in the printing house of Flor. Ungler. Jan of Lańcut was probably from Landshut in Bavaria; he resided in Cracow in 1499-1501 and from 1513 probably until his death in 1516, a famous Polish mathematician, professor at the Cracow academy, author of "Arithmetic" (1513), which served as a textbook for a long time. Traces of dampstain, stains and woodworm, non-fraying of page edges, 1 card missing: "D1". b . rare .
